Steve Jobs Was Wrong

Slate: In the fall of 2010, Steve Jobs made an unusual appearance on an Apple earnings call. He’d come to rant. The CEO had prepared a nine-minute broadside against Android, Google’s mobile operating system, and all of the Android tablets that were being rushed into production to take on the iPad. Many of those devices carried 7-inch screens, making them substantially smaller than the iPad, whose display is nearly 10 inches diagonally.
